Output 68d853e8307a393024a24266b91541ca0ae020c13cf47985ce3d32e4a1ef053a:0

value
12515500
script pubkey
OP_0 OP_PUSHBYTES_20 819444401ad5bb23e12ebeb79cc85cbfb0621910
address
bc1qsx2ygsq66kaj8cfwh6meejzuh7cxyxgs8z6ql5
transaction
68d853e8307a393024a24266b91541ca0ae020c13cf47985ce3d32e4a1ef053a
spent
true